Can anyone guide to the options available in Repeat Region?

 

I want BOM where all the PARTS should be in BOM and not a single Assembly.

Also want all components of the sub-assemblies of top-level assembly.

 

I know the option of "recursive" and "filter"

 

But i want that Table.tbl file to be saved for future uses.

 

Right now when i am saving the table file after applying all settings like recursive and filter by rule "&asm.mbr.type==PART*

 

Next time when i use that table file. It only shows the PARTS of Top level assembly. And all sub-assemblies along with it parts get filtered out.

So every time i have to work with BOM for the same.

 

And everytime to identify the PART/ASSEMBLY i have to again add 1 column of &asm.mbr.type (Unwanted) and then i start to set default all settings to BOM and again have to apply the settings.

 

Can anybody help here?

 

Best answer by MartinHanak

Hi,

I can't see any problem ... see attached files created in CR2 M070.

  1. I created new drawing
  2. I set asm0001.asm as drawing model
  3. I imported table from table_2019-02-21.tbl
  4. table contains recursive BOM, indentation is set to 0, filter enables PARTs only
